Methane (CH4) emissions from Industrial Processes in Albania
Albania: Methane (CH4) emissions from Industrial Processes was 0.0022 Mt CO2e in 2024. ◆ Volatile
Methane (CH4) emissions from Industrial Processes in Albania, 1970–2024
Source: EDGAR (Emissions Database for Global Atmospheric Research) Community GHG Database, Joint Research Centre (JRC) - European Commission. Measured in Mt CO2e.
Analysis
The most recent figure for methane (ch4) emissions from industrial processes in Albania is 0.0022 Mt CO2e, measured in 2024.
That represents a change of down 4.3% on the previous year and up 100.0% over ten years.
Over the whole period, methane (ch4) emissions from industrial processes in Albania peaked at 0.006 Mt CO2e in 1974 and was at its lowest, 0 Mt CO2e, in 2007.
That places Albania 64th out of 94 countries with data for 2024, putting it in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.
Averages by decade
| Decade | Average | Lowest | Highest | Years |
|---|---|---|---|---|
| 1970s | 0.0045 Mt CO2e | 0.0031 Mt CO2e | 0.006 Mt CO2e | 10 |
| 1980s | 0.0018 Mt CO2e | 0.0006 Mt CO2e | 0.0035 Mt CO2e | 10 |
| 1990s | 0.0011 Mt CO2e | 0.0007 Mt CO2e | 0.0016 Mt CO2e | 10 |
| 2000s | 0.0006 Mt CO2e | 0 Mt CO2e | 0.0012 Mt CO2e | 10 |
| 2010s | 0.0013 Mt CO2e | 0.0007 Mt CO2e | 0.0029 Mt CO2e | 10 |
| 2020s | 0.0024 Mt CO2e | 0.0016 Mt CO2e | 0.0032 Mt CO2e | 5 |

About this data
A measure of annual emissions of methane (CH4), one of the six Kyoto greenhouse gases (GHG), from industrial processes including IPCC 2006 codes 2.A.1 Cement production, 2.A.2 Lime production, 2.A.3 Glass Production, 2.A.4 Other Process Uses of Carbonates, 2.B Chemical Industry, 2.C Metal Industry, 2.D Non-Energy Products from Fuels and Solvent Use, 2.E Electronics Industry, 2.F Product Uses as Substitutes for Ozone Depleting Substances, 2.G Other Product Manufacture and Use and 5.A Indirect N2O emissions from the atmospheric deposition of nitrogen in NOx and NH3.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
